Product Description

The SNAP-TITE H Series Hydraulic Quick-Connect Coupling Body (MPN BVHC12-12M) is a brass-bodied coupling with a 3/4"-14 thread size, a maximum flow rate of 681.3 lpm, and a nitrile seal. 3G Electric interprets this demand and sources the genuine SNAP-TITE component, supporting your hydraulic system needs across our 14 industrial departments.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the SNAP-TITE H Series hydraulic quick-connect coupling used for?

The SNAP-TITE H Series coupling body (MPN BVHC12-12M) is used for quick, leak-free connection and disconnection of hydraulic lines in industrial fluid power systems. It is commonly applied in mobile equipment, machine tools, and hydraulic power units where reliable, high-flow connections are needed.

What are the specifications of the SNAP-TITE BVHC12-12M coupling?

The SNAP-TITE BVHC12-12M is a brass-bodied hydraulic quick-connect coupling body with a 3/4"-14 thread size, a maximum flow rate of 681.3 lpm, and a nitrile seal. It is part of the H Series and is designed for high-flow hydraulic applications.

How to select the right SNAP-TITE quick-connect coupling for my system?

Select a SNAP-TITE coupling by matching thread size, seal material, and flow rate to your system's pressure and fluid compatibility. For the BVHC12-12M, verify your line uses a 3/4"-14 thread and that nitrile seals suit your hydraulic fluid. Consult your system's pressure rating to ensure proper coupling selection.
